The vast majority of Hindu's worship Shiva as God. Shiva is called Allah in Islam, and God the Father in Christianity. Krishna was believed to be an incarnation of Vishnu, but with energies of Shiva also. That is why he is considered the most powerful incarnation of Vishnu, as he had qualities of Shiva also. Lord Buddha was also an incarnation of Vishnu.
@3tpath
@3tpath 5 күн бұрын
A few caveats: First, the predominant concept in India is Vaishnavism, not Shivaism, so it's not the case that the vast majority worship Shiva, instead they worship Vishnu, more specifically Rama and Krishna. Secondly, God is one. So, it's not that Christians and Muslims are worshiping Shiva, rather they are worshipping God according to their understanding of God. Since we understand God to be Vishnu, Krishna, and even Shiva, then, in that regard, we can state that other religions are worshipping the same God in a general sense, though not in the same sense we are. As for Buda, he's not God, but rather an empowered "avesa" avatar. A soul empowered to help humanity.

Lord Shiva is a god of course, but Lord Vishnu is THE God. Vedas declare him as the para-brahman (the supreme most reality, origin of everything including other gods) in Narayana sukta and he's called the parama-purusha (the supreme consciousness) in Purusha Sukta of the Rig Veda. The rig veda also says that Lord Vishnu creates everyone and everything but no one creates Lord Vishnu. This is why Krishna says in the gita that neither demigods nor sages know of his origin because Krishna is Narayana himself, the ultimate supreme reality, the basis of existence. So while you're right about Hindus worshipping Shiva as a god, just like they worship the sun as a god, you're wrong about them worshipping Lord Shiva as The God (with a capital G).

@@johnpembroke4899 No Rig veda never mentions him has the para-brahman. In fact, they specifically say that no one and nothing creates lord Vishnu, and no such thing has been repeated for any other god in the vedas. Also, there cannot be 2 para-brahmans, creation would simply be impossible if that were the case (Shankaracharya admits in his Bhashya). The word para-brahman itself refers to one supreme entity and the word supreme (param) requires a hierarchy of things to be self-evident.
